Address

DEuPbQ19cw4mrHkbEoBFX6aMG265uqpZqa

0 DGB

Confirmed
Total Received 465.09681285 DGB4.07 USD
Total Sent 465.09681285 DGB4.07 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DEuPbQ19cw4mrHkbEoBFX6aMG265uqpZqa 465.09681285 DGB4.07 USD4.07 USD
 
DRg8fW9i1AMjwtXaT3Rms8aJmxnPjPn4J9 0.63814800 DGB0.01 USD0.01 USD
DFwTwDGiMSZ4niKsVMARJc17kRGTU6tudo 464.45843980 DGB4.06 USD4.06 USD
DD8hx86MT2Vn8Xg8dmiVX75vY9kz1Lqh9B 493.54361590 DGB4.31 USD4.31 USD
 
DEuPbQ19cw4mrHkbEoBFX6aMG265uqpZqa 465.09681285 DGB4.07 USD4.07 USD
dgb1q58zgrrw9e76asahmpe3rt3xyawn8pjzk7t3enx 28.44658100 DGB0.25 USD0.25 USD